ASSDC Chairman, Onyedum Thumbs Up CEO Neros Pharmaceuticals, Chief Emenike For Contributions To Sports Development

By Ikenna Nwokedi

Patrick Estate Onyedum, Chairman, Anambra State Sports Development Commission (ASSDC) has eulogized the MD/CEO of Neros Pharmaceuticals Ltd for his immense contributions toward football and by extension Sports development in the state.

Onyedum made the commendation in a letter dated 24th February, 2025 with the caption, “A Note of Appreciation.”

The letter reads: “I, on behalf of the management and staff of the *Anambra State Sports Development Commission (ASSDC)* and by extension football afficionados wish to eulogize and appreciate you Sir for your immense contributions to football growth and development in our dear, Anambra State.

The 19th edition of the 2025 Neros Pharmaceuticals Anambra FA Cup is a testament to your passion for sports development through the instrumentality of football and human capital development via Sports.

We deeply appreciate your benevolence and philantropic gesture in this regard and we pray for God’s continuous blessings, good health and divine protection upon you as you continue in your giant stride of taking football development to an accelerated level in our state.

Thank you Sir for your contributions and sporting regards,” The letter read.

Chief Prof. Poly Emenike has been the sole financier of the Neros Pharmaceuticals/Anambra FA Cup which he has bankrolled for 19 years since 2006.

The Anambra State version of the FA Cup is the most rewarding in the land with the winner going home with the sum of two million naira, while the first runners-up and second runners-up are also rewarded with the sum of one million and N500 thousand respectively with the fourth placed side also getting a consolation of N100 thousand.

The 2025 edition which was the 19th edition saw Edel FC beating the defending champions Solution FC 2-0 on penalty shootouts after the pulsating encounter ended goalless at the end of regulation time.
